Celebrate the art of nature with this stunning card collection of vintage illustrations by naturalists and botanists of the past. This card set contains four each of five different designs, each featuring beautiful illustrations of botanicals, flying beetles, garden snakes and more. Packaged in a gorgeous, keepsake portfolio with ribbon tie and including coordinating envelopes and envelope seals, this card set is perfect for your correspondence needs and makes a wonderful gift.

Scott Campbell, sometimes known as Scott C., is the creator of the GREAT SHOWDOWNS online series and Double Fine Action Comics. He was art director and concept artist at Double Fine Productions on such games as Psychonauts, Brutal Legend, and Broken Age. His illustrated picture books include Zombie in Love, Zombie in Love 2 + 1, East Dragon West Dragon, XO, OX: A Love Story, Bob Dylan's If Dogs Run Free and Hug Machine, in which he has written the words as well as created the pictures. Scott lives in New York City.
